Protect SaaS environments with a 1-year FortiCASB SSPM subscription sized for 10,000 users. This service is built for teams that need clear visibility into cloud application posture, tighter control over configuration risk, and a practical way to manage SaaS governance at scale. When identity sprawl and misconfigurations can expose sensitive data, posture management becomes a core control rather than an optional add-on.
FortiCASB SSPM helps security and infrastructure teams monitor SaaS settings, identify risky configurations, and keep policy alignment in view across the applications employees rely on every day. The 10K user entitlement makes it suitable for larger deployments where manual review is no longer sustainable.
